Do I Need Brass or Aluminum Transmitters with my TireMinder TPSM System

Question:
2019 Jayco Seneca Good afternoon, Do you have in stock? Google search states out of stock. I read about brass vs aluminun vavle stems. My RV have the stainless steel valve extensions, are the brass tps ok? My futute toad vehicle has factory tps, but rubber valve stems. Brass ok there? Thank you in advance,
asked by: Tony P
Expert Reply:
This is a good question, and it's going to vary between RVs and towed vehicles, so I'll try to break this down. The short version of this is that for your setup you'll want to use brass transmitters. Towed vehicles will have either rubber (brass) or metal (aluminum) valve stems in the wheels. If you have a rubber valve stem, you will need brass transmitters like the ones that come in the TireMinder # TM79FR. If you have a metal valve stem on your towed vehicle, you will need aluminum transmitters like the TireMinder # TM-2ALUM.
RVs, MotorHomes, 5TH Wheels and Trailers will all have either rubber (brass) or metal (steel, chrome or nickel) valve stems. All of these types of valve stems work with the TireMinder brass transmitters like the ones in the # TM79FR. For this reason, you'll be able to use all brass transmitters on both your RV and toad, so there's no need to purchase additional transmitters to use with your TireMinder system.
